    This is awesome. As a blind rehabilitation professional I just wish the audience could of witnessed what the actual adaptations are besides braille labeling like bump dots and high marks (puff paint) on the stove/oven/microwave so the person with the visual impairment has a tactual reference of what the buttons are like an"x" on the cancel button ect. A liquid level indicator so the person can hear a beeping noise when the level of the liquid you are pouring is reaching near the top of the pouring container. Using apps on the phone like TapTapSee/Be My Eyes/Be Specular/Seeing AI to read labels of ingredients or identifying the objects on the table. I know Molly expressed her lack of interest in cooking and thats totally ok and I understand why she doesnt have these adaptations if its something she chooses not to do, but so the viewers know cooking/baking blind can be done without someone having to verbally describe to you everything you are doing.

    @zuzuspetals9281 6 лет назад

    I got the 11-year old across the street things to help her bake this Fall. She is blind and each Halloween we get her gifts to encourage her to be independent, and your videos have helped so much with ideas. Every Christmas their family makes candies and cookies to give away for gifts so this year I thought measuring spoons and cups marked with Braille would help her participate in their baking, and I got her the liquid pour measuring tool you showed a while back. Last year we gave her a talking watch. Thanks for all your videos and ideas, I've recommended you to her and her mom. Keep doing what you do.

    Molly I love your channel! I'm a Pastry Chef! My one thing I love to do is learn how to bake for all food allergies/ restrictions. I also love teaching people baking! I remember in college for on of my baking labs, one of my chefs had us blindfolded and we had to feel the different flours, sugar, salt basically all of it and we had to guess what it was! He actually tested us over it too! I'm so glad he taught us that because now I don't need my sight if something isn't labeled I just need to feel it and know what it is! And one of my coworkers she is blind! I love working with her she is such a sweet lady! I told her about your RUclips channel and she put it in her phone to check your channel out! She loves to hear about what other blind people do and how successful people who are blind are!
